Airtel to soon launch smart SIM cards in India

Bharti Airtel will soon launch an adaptable SIM card, smart SIM, across the country that will save consumers the hassles of changing their SIM card whenever they change their handset.

Airtel will offer customers a unique SIM adaptor (2 adaptors) which provides customers the freedom of switching between nano-, micro- and mini-SIM compatible devices.

“The SIM runs best with smartphones, tablets, phablets, dongles and connected cameras,” a senior executive in Bharti Airtel said.

At present, more and more customers are moving from feature phones to smartphones, which also means a shift from a mini-SIM to a micro- or nano-SIM. With Airtel’s smart-SIM a customer can seamlessly shift between devices offering 2G, 3G or 4G connections. Smart SIM will also have more storage space compared to the present SIM cards, which means one can store more contacts.

Other operators such as Vodafone, RCom and Aircel too are exploring issue of similar smart-SIMs. The smart SIM has been designed keeping in mind the unique needs of data centric customers who use a smartphone or a tablet.
